Google Crome Problem

Featured Replies

I am up in Chiang Mai and find the some days, not all, when I am on the net connecting via Google Crome I log onto web sites but all though the Page opens it never opens fully and the Blue cicle next to page title never completes so I am never able to read the rest of the page.

Firefox and Safarai are operating in a Normal manner.

The problem has only occured from say 10.00 AM onward. Earlier in the day Google operates normally.

I just received a reply on the CM forum which advised that I cleared my History and catche.

I have a Beat version of CC Cleaner and just used it to clean out the history and cache.

Normal service seems to have been restored.
